After running up against some technical and structural limitations of the original system, Nothing's creators considered moving the whole thing to a different web site, called nothing2. However, they quickly decided that it would be more in keeping with the project to simply wipe Nothing out of existence and replace it with the new and improved version.

Users of Nothing didn't notice much difference after the changeover, except that several nodes had inexplicably sprung back into existence. Obviously, this was irritating to the users who had put so much effort into annihilating these nodes, but after a bit of huffing and puffing, all of the stray nodes were tracked down and obliterated.
